About Le Meridien New York, Central Park by Marriott
Located 1056 feet from Central Park and 0.8 mi from Times Square, Le Méridien New York, Central Park offers rooms and suites in Midtown Manhattan. All rooms at Le Méridien New York, Central Park come with 40-inch flat-screen TVs and Beats by Dr. Dre™ sound systems. Le Méridien Central Park offers two distinct food and beverage experiences. Paris Bar, located on the ground level, is a French brasserie serving breakfast, lunch, and dinner daily. On the rooftop, Le Jardin Rooftop features light bites and specialty cocktails, complemented by views of Central Park. Other onsite amenities include fitness center and complimentary nightly turndown service. Radio City Music Hall is located 2113 feet from the property and Rockefeller Center is 2641 feet away. Columbus Circle is 1588 feet from the property. - Le Méridien New York Central Park is committed to providing its guests and associates with a smoke free environment.
